    Preparation of the Organized Nanowire Array of Nickel and Its Magnetization Hysteresis Loops

    • An organized nanowire array can be prepared by means of the template of porous alumina obtained from aluminum electrooxidation in an aqueous solution of 15% sulfuric acid.The army of Ni nanowires electro-deposited in the template is highly organized and arranged regularly. The measurements of magnetization hysteresis loops show that the nickel nanowire array, with the diameter of 10nm and the aspect ratio of 400, possesses the coercivity of 831Oe, in the direction perpendicular to the alumina surface (i.e. along the length of nickel nanowires),and the squareness of 0.91, characteristic of marked magnetic single-axis anisotropy and the property of single domain.
